I let the dough rise for 30 minutes. I covered dough with a towel and kept in a warm humid part of the house.
During that time I picked the fresh basil and washed it well.
I grated mozzarella cheese, sliced the tomatoes, olives and basil. All ready to put on top of the pizza.
My brother wanted a thin crust so I used a cookie sheet and spread dough out very thin. I add a small amount of olive oil on the pan to give the bottom of the crust and nice taste.
Bake pizza in pre-heated oven at 350 degrees. It took 15 minutes with the thin crust, but make sure to check for browning and melted cheese every 5-10 minutes as ovens vary.
Recipe
- 1 pkg. rapid rise yeast (or 3 teaspoons yeast)
- 1 cup warm water
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 3 Cups flour
- 1 teaspoon salt
- Pizza sauce or spaghetti sauce
- Fresh basil
- Fresh roma tomoatoes
- Other fixins like olives, pineapple, pepperoni, etc.
